The sound of children’s laughter and music echoing from the gymnasium and activity rooms of the LaRosa Youth Club in McKeesport brought joyful tears to the eyes of many club stakeholders Wednesday night. The Ravine Street clubhouse is reopening for youngsters Monday thanks to generous donors and the hard work of the recently formed LaRosa Youth Development Foundation nonprofit organization, which collaborated with Mayor Michael Cherepko, state Sen. Jim Brewster and state Rep. Austin Davis, three Democrats who grew up playing ball, making friends and getting mentored at LaRosa Club.
